WebMar 27, 2024 · If you are filing a joint return and only your spouse owes a debt to the Tax Department or another New York State agency, you can separate your part of the refund. For more information on filing for nonobligated spouse relief, see Form IT-280, Nonobligated Spouse Allocation. Note: Form IT-280 must be submitted with your original return (not an ... firefox vf
